arm64: dts: qcom: monaco-arduino-monza: Add Bluetooth UART node
The QCA2066 Bluetooth chip is powered by a board-level 3.3 V supply
provided by the hardware. This change connects the Bluetooth
controller via UART10, and the corresponding GPIO is used to enable
the Bluetooth chip.
basic function test step:
- bluetoothctl power on/off
- bluetoothctl scan bredr/le
- bluetoothctl pair <remote device address>
- bluetoothctl connect <remote device address>
